Pokemon and Build-a-Bear are teaming up once again, this time adding the Water/Ground-type Wooper to the collection. The continuing collaboration between Build-a-Bear and Pokemon seems to show no signs of slowing down or ending, and regularly adds new Pokemon to the roster.
Thus far, Build-a-Bear has released over 40 Pokemon collaborations, with the series of plush creatures reaching its 10th anniversary later this year. While a number of the Pokemon released into the series have been from the earlier generations, with quite a few being Eeveelution Build-a-Bears, the line has gone as far as Pokemon Scarlet and Violet for inspiration. Now, the series is turning its attention back to Gen 2, with a Pokemon that originally premiered in Pokemon Gold and Silver.
